Origins and Background of GameArt
GameArt is a software provider founded in 2013, based in Italy. It focuses on developing casino games with high-quality visuals and engaging mechanics. Its reputation stems from collaboration with various online casino operators and a consistent expansion of its game portfolio. As a developer, GameArt prioritises compliance with jurisdictional regulations, especially within the European market.
The Core Mechanism of GameArt Platforms
GameArt does not operate casinos directly. Instead, it supplies game software and solutions to licensed online operators. These operators integrate GameArt’s titles into their sites, allowing players to access a variety of slot games, table games, and instant wins.
Game Development and Licensing
GameArt produces games that are certified for fairness and randomness through independent testing agencies. Their titles feature diverse themes, innovative bonus features, and high-definition graphics. Casinos using GameArt software must obtain licensing from authorities such as the UK Gambling Commission, which ensures their compliance with standards.
Integration and Platform Support
GameArt offers a backend platform that allows operators to customise game presentations, manage promotions, and monitor player activity. The integration process involves embedding the game client within the casino’s website or app, with security measures in place to protect user data.

Security and Fair Play
The games supplied by GameArt are subject to regular audits by independent testing labs such as eCOGRA or iTech Labs. These checks verify that outcomes are genuinely random, ensuring fairness for players. Licensing from the UK Gambling Commission further mandates strict adherence to responsible gambling policies.

Regulatory Environment and Compliance
The operation of GameArt-powered casinos in the UK depends on adherence to the Gambling Act 2005 and regulations enforced by the UK Gambling Commission. These laws enforce rigorous standards concerning game fairness, player protection, and anti-money laundering measures.
Implications for Players
Players can verify the legitimacy of a GameArt casino by checking its licensing status with the UKGC. Licensed sites undergo routine inspections, providing confidence in game integrity and payout reliability.
